Getting help

Email [CONTACT EMAIL]. We answer within two working days, in German or English.

For anything involving someone's safety, put SAFETY in the subject line and we will look at it the same day.

This mailbox is also our single point of contact for users under Art. 12 DSA and for authorities and the European Commission under Art. 11 DSA.

Reporting content (Art. 16 DSA)

Every piece of content in Komos can be reported from where you're standing, in two taps:

You pick a reason: harassment or bullying, spam or scam, pretending to be someone else, inappropriate content, "I felt unsafe", or something else.

You do not need an account to report something you believe is illegal — email [CONTACT EMAIL] with a link or a description of where it is, an explanation of why it is illegal, and your name and email (not required for reports concerning offences under Articles 3 to 7 of Directive 2011/93/EU). We will confirm receipt, decide without undue delay, and tell you the outcome and how to challenge it.

Blocking

Blocking is one tap from a profile, and it is silent — the person blocked is told nothing and simply stops being able to see you or your plans. You can see and undo your blocks in Settings → Blocked accounts.

Your account and your data

You can edit everything on your profile in the app, and delete your account from Settings — immediately, without asking us. What deletion does and does not remove, and every right you have over your data, is in the privacy policy.
